From e00f3e96363e2549285f0687ac7220bbad3c5183 Mon Sep 17 00:00:00 2001 From: Jens Steube Date: Fri, 12 Jun 2020 08:57:59 +0200 Subject: [PATCH] Add optimized fake kernels for -m 2000 to enable hashcat to respect user decision to use pure or optimized password candidate generators in --stdout mode --- OpenCL/m02000_a0-optimized.cl | 35 +++++++++++++++++++++++++++++++++++ OpenCL/m02000_a1-optimized.cl | 35 +++++++++++++++++++++++++++++++++++ OpenCL/m02000_a3-optimized.cl | 35 +++++++++++++++++++++++++++++++++++ 3 files changed, 105 insertions(+) create mode 100644 OpenCL/m02000_a0-optimized.cl create mode 100644 OpenCL/m02000_a1-optimized.cl create mode 100644 OpenCL/m02000_a3-optimized.cl diff --git a/OpenCL/m02000_a0-optimized.cl b/OpenCL/m02000_a0-optimized.cl new file mode 100644 index 000000000..5d37b01d7 --- /dev/null +++ b/OpenCL/m02000_a0-optimized.cl @@ -0,0 +1,35 @@ +/** + * Author......: See docs/credits.txt + * License.....: MIT + */ + +#ifdef KERNEL_STATIC +#include "inc_vendor.h" +#include "inc_types.h" +#include "inc_platform.cl" +#include "inc_common.cl" +#endif + +KERNEL_FQ void m02000_m04 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_m08 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_m16 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_s04 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_s08 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_s16 (KERN_ATTR_RULES ()) +{ +} diff --git a/OpenCL/m02000_a1-optimized.cl b/OpenCL/m02000_a1-optimized.cl new file mode 100644 index 000000000..5d37b01d7 --- /dev/null +++ b/OpenCL/m02000_a1-optimized.cl @@ -0,0 +1,35 @@ +/** + * Author......: See docs/credits.txt + * License.....: MIT + */ + +#ifdef KERNEL_STATIC +#include "inc_vendor.h" +#include "inc_types.h" +#include "inc_platform.cl" +#include "inc_common.cl" +#endif + +KERNEL_FQ void m02000_m04 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_m08 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_m16 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_s04 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_s08 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_s16 (KERN_ATTR_RULES ()) +{ +} diff --git a/OpenCL/m02000_a3-optimized.cl b/OpenCL/m02000_a3-optimized.cl new file mode 100644 index 000000000..5d37b01d7 --- /dev/null +++ b/OpenCL/m02000_a3-optimized.cl @@ -0,0 +1,35 @@ +/** + * Author......: See docs/credits.txt + * License.....: MIT + */ + +#ifdef KERNEL_STATIC +#include "inc_vendor.h" +#include "inc_types.h" +#include "inc_platform.cl" +#include "inc_common.cl" +#endif + +KERNEL_FQ void m02000_m04 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_m08 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_m16 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_s04 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_s08 (KERN_ATTR_RULES ()) +{ +} + +KERNEL_FQ void m02000_s16 (KERN_ATTR_RULES ()) +{ +}